Hello again, Is there actually a difference between the, 2+2 seater and 2 seater Body Panels? Like, I know the 2+2 seater is longer, but is it just longer on the sides or are the other panels, affected by this too? Eg: Front Bumper. Rear Bumper. Side Skirts. Front & Rear Fenders.
It's not referred to as either of these things. All removable panels are the same, front bar, guards, bonnet. Everything behind the windscreen could be slightly different. For example, the fuel lids are different between the two.
Ive never heard of the 2+2 being called a limo, but ive heard it called a boat lol. LWB & SWB is what the UK 2+2 & 2+0 zeds are referred to respectively, possibly in other countries aswell. As for differences, anything after the front pillars back is different from what ive read, so that includes doors, rear quarter inc fuel lid, rear bar. Hope that helps. Abraham
Yeah nobody has ever called it a 'limo'. As a general rule of thumb most parts behind the a pillar are different between the two.
and bonnet is the same as well. doors, targa tops, boot hatch, rear bumper, rear quarters , door sills are all different.
